Main duties of the job
Duties include, but are not limited to ;
* Venepuncture
* Cannulation
* ECG recording
* Supporting with booking patients for future appointments
* Maintain a high standard of record keeping ensuring all entries are accurate and legible
The role requires close liaison with other disciplines and the provision of a courteous, reliable and quality service to patient's relatives and carers, healthcare professionals and all wards and departments across the Trust.

Person Specification
* Good standard of General Education to GCSE level or equivalent
* NVQ Level 3 or NHS accredited Care Certificate
* Able to demonstrate a good standard of literacy and numeracy
* Evidence of practical training or education in a care setting.
* Venepuncture, ECG and cannulation skills
* Practical skills in providing essential aspects of care.
* Extended IT skills including ICs, ICE, Web V (training will be provided)
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
